Question 1: What is the primary purpose of a Gage R&R study in the Measure phase?
- To assess the repeatability and reproducibility of a measurement system (Correct answer)
- To calculate process capability indices
- To identify root causes of defects
- To establish control limits for a process
Correct answer: To assess the repeatability and reproducibility of a measurement system
A Gage R&R study evaluates whether a measurement system produces consistent results across different operators and repeated measurements.
Question 2: Which metric represents the total number of defect opportunities per million in a process?
- Cp
- DPMO (Correct answer)
- Cpk
- RTY
Correct answer: DPMO
Defects Per Million Opportunities (DPMO) quantifies the defect rate normalized to one million opportunities, enabling comparison across different processes.
Question 3: A process has a Cpk of 0.8. What does this indicate?
- The process is highly capable and centered
- The process is not capable of meeting specifications (Correct answer)
- The process has no variation
- The process exceeds Six Sigma performance
Correct answer: The process is not capable of meeting specifications
A Cpk below 1.0 indicates the process is not capable of consistently producing output within specification limits.
Question 4: What type of data would you collect when recording the number of scratches found on a painted surface?
- Continuous data
- Discrete (attribute) data (Correct answer)
- Variable data
- Nominal data
Correct answer: Discrete (attribute) data
Counting defects such as scratches produces discrete attribute data because each scratch is a countable, whole-number event.
Question 5: In a measurement system analysis, what does 'reproducibility' specifically evaluate?
- Variation due to different operators measuring the same part (Correct answer)
- Variation within one operator measuring the same part repeatedly
- Variation caused by the measuring instrument's calibration
- Variation between different parts in the sample
Correct answer: Variation due to different operators measuring the same part
Reproducibility measures the variation introduced when different operators use the same gage to measure identical parts.
Question 6: Which tool is used to visually display the frequency distribution of collected process data during the Measure phase?
- Fishbone diagram
- Histogram (Correct answer)
- SIPOC diagram
- Failure mode matrix
Correct answer: Histogram
A histogram displays data in bars representing frequency intervals, making it easy to see the shape, spread, and center of a data distribution.
